Fast women heading to educational days at British Motor Museum

Leamington Editorial 3rd Jun, 2023   0

FAST women will be joining youngsters at the British Motor Museum later this month

The Gaydon museum will host two special ST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ering and Maths) Careers days for secondary school pupils on June 27 an 28.

The first day will be a Girls in STEM Day, providing a safe space for girls to meet with industry professionals and inspirational women from the STEM workforce.

The day will begin with a presentation and Q&A with Jenny Eyes, digital Ppoduct chief at Jaguar Land Rover.




And a a day of activities, pupils will have the chance to meet Eliza Seville, Formula Woman 2022 winner and mechanic and test pilot at Roborace, and Chloe Grant from Laser Tools GB4 Racing Team, to discover what it takes to be a successful woman in motorsport.

The following day, the museum will host a STEM Careers Day open to all pupils. After an presentation from industry partners, pupils will take an interactive tour of the collection, race remote-controlled Jaguar D-types around a special track, try out some hands-on science activities with the STEM ambassadors from MoD Kineton and much more.


Their day will culminate with a special presentation from Eliza.

Claire Broader, from the museum’s learning and engagement team, said: “We hope our STEM Careers Days will inspire and empower the engineers and scientists of the future! It will be an exciting day of immersive and interactive learning in a unique setting, surrounded by our amazing collection of historic British cars.”

The cost is £12.50 per pupil. The museum’s travel support scheme is also available to help cover schools’ transport costs.

* The British Motor Museum has opened a new exhibition entitled ‘The Gallery: Auto Art at the British Motor Museum’ which will run until June 30.

The exhibition, which is run in collaboration with Historic Car Art, features a collection of over 30 motoring-related pieces from seven of Britain’s most creative automotive artists and sculptors.
